Google ogłasza oficjalną obsługę Androida RISC-V

Google oficjalnie ogłosiło wsparcie dla architektury RISC-V, alternatywnego ISA bez opłat licencyjnych.

Android, system operacyjny opracowany przez Google, obsługuje obecnie kilka różnych architektur zestawu instrukcji (ISA), takich jak ARM i x86. Większość urządzeń korzystających z Androida, w tym smartfony, tablety, telewizory i smartwatche, korzysta z chipsetów opartych na ARM. Intel zaprzestał produkcji procesorów do telefonów, a obsługa MIPS została usunięta w wersji 17 NDK. Jednak jest jeden ISA, o którym jest dużo gadania Rwykształcony Iinstrukcja Si.t Ckomputer V, RISC-V, który jest darmowym i otwartym ISA. Każdy może projektować oparte na nich chipy bez ponoszenia żadnych opłat licencyjnych ani tantiem, a Google ogłosił oficjalne wsparcie dla tego rozwiązania podczas przemówienia firmy, które odbyło się podczas szczytu RISC-V.

RISC-V jest wyjątkowy, ponieważ jest bezpłatnym i otwartym ISA, a dostawcy chcący wytwarzać tanie produkty IoT będą zainteresowani wykorzystaniem RISC-V do opracowywania tanich chipów. Jednocześnie pilnie będą szukać tego firmy chcące zmniejszyć swoją zależność od konkurentów lub podmiotów zagranicznych. Co ciekawe,

Google już z tego korzysta architekturę RISC-V dla układu zabezpieczającego Titan M2 z serii Google Pixel oraz Intel oferuje teraz do produkcji chipsetów RISC-V dla klientów komercyjnych.

Podczas przemówienia firmy Lars Bergstrom, dyrektor ds. inżynierii Androida, powiedział, że chce, aby RISC-V było postrzegane jako „platforma pierwszego poziomu” w systemie Android. Jest to porównywalne z tym, czym obecnie jest Arm dla Androida, co jest dość odważnym krokiem w obliczu czegoś, co wcześniej wydawało się całkowitym brakiem zainteresowania ze strony Google. Zespół Androida w odpowiedzi na ArsTechnicaRon Amadeo, gdy zapytał zespół, czy na konferencji Google I/O 2022 planowana jest obsługa RISC-V, zdawał się sugerować, że RISC-V nie pojawi się w najbliższym czasie. Na pytanie firmy Amadeo dotyczące obsługi RISC-V w przyszłości odpowiedź brzmiała: „Przyglądamy się, ale byłaby to dla nas duża zmiana”.

Bergstrom twierdzi, że można już pobrać i wypróbować bardzo ograniczoną wersję Androida dla RISC-V, ale nie obsługuje ona środowiska wykonawczego Android Runtime (ART) dla obciążeń Java. Powiedział, że spodziewa się wkrótce udostępnić oficjalne wsparcie dla emulatorów, a ART pojawi się w pierwszym kwartale 2023 roku. Udostępnił powyższy slajd, który pokazuje, że chociaż jest wiele do zrobienia, aby uruchomić AOSP na RISC-V, firma jest zaangażowana w architekturę.

Najlepsze w tym wszystkim jest to, że programiści nie będą musieli wiele robić, aby ich aplikacje działały na urządzeniach RISC-V. ART zasadniczo „tłumaczy” kod bajtowy na natywne instrukcje urządzenia, na którym działa, więc będzie to tłumaczenie na RISC-V zamiast na Arm. Kod natywny to inna historia, ale kod Java stanowi całość większości aplikacji na Androida.

Jeśli chodzi o powody, dla których firmy mogą chcieć odejść od Arm, jest kilka powodów. Zacznijmy od tego, że spółka była niezwykle niestabilna. SoftBank, jego właściciel, próbował sprzedać firmę Nvidii, ale to się nie powiodło. Arm stał się także pionkiem sankcji handlowych nałożonych na firmy takie jak Huawei, z którymi został zmuszony do zerwania kontaktów na kilka miesięcy. Jeszcze gorsze jest to Arm pozwał Qualcomm w związku z zakupem Nuvii, a pozywanie jednego z największych klientów nie wygląda najlepiej.

RISC-V jest postrzegany jako ucieczka od zachodniej zależności, a w dużej mierze jest to spowodowane inkorporacją RISC-V International w Szwajcarii. Może działać jako neutralna strona zarówno w stosunku do Stanów Zjednoczonych, jak i Chin, co czyni go atrakcyjną opcją dla firm chcących projektować chipsety. Alibaba jest jednym z największych zwolenników RISC-V i inżynierowie firmy przenieśli Androida 10 na płytę RISC-V dwa lata temu.

Będziemy obserwować i czekać, aby zobaczyć, jak RISC-V będzie się kształtował w nadchodzących miesiącach. Chociaż prawdopodobnie minie trochę czasu, zanim pojawią się na rynku opłacalne urządzenia flagowe z chipsetami RISC-V, Google otwiera drzwi firmom, aby z pewnością spróbowały.


Źródło: Google

Przez: ArsTechnica